25 struct ossl_store_ctx_st {
26 const OSSL_STORE_LOADER *loader;
27 OSSL_STORE_LOADER_CTX *loader_ctx;
28 const UI_METHOD *ui_method;
29 void *ui_data;
30 OSSL_STORE_post_process_info_fn post_process;
31 void *post_process_data;
32 int expected_type;
33
34 /* 0 before the first STORE_load(), 1 otherwise */
35 int loading;
36 };
37
38 OSSL_STORE_CTX *OSSL_STORE_open(const char *uri, const UI_METHOD *ui_method,
39 void *ui_data,
40 OSSL_STORE_post_process_info_fn post_process,
41 void *post_process_data)
42 {
43 const OSSL_STORE_LOADER *loader = NULL;
44 OSSL_STORE_LOADER_CTX *loader_ctx = NULL;
45 OSSL_STORE_CTX *ctx = NULL;
46 char scheme_copy[256], *p, *schemes[2];
47 size_t schemes_n = 0;
48 size_t i;
49
50 /*
51 * Put the file scheme first. If the uri does represent an existing file,
52 * possible device name and all, then it should be loaded. Only a failed
53 * attempt at loading a local file should have us try something else.
54 */
55 schemes[schemes_n++] = "file";
56
57 /*
58 * Now, check if we have something that looks like a scheme, and add it
59 * as a second scheme. However, also check if there's an authority start
60 * (://), because that will invalidate the previous file scheme. Also,
61 * check that this isn't actually the file scheme, as there's no point
62 * going through that one twice!
63 */
64 OPENSSL_strlcpy(scheme_copy, uri, sizeof(scheme_copy));
65 if ((p = strchr(scheme_copy, ':')) != NULL) {
66 *p++ = '\0';
67 if (strcasecmp(scheme_copy, "file") != 0) {
68 if (strncmp(p, "//", 2) == 0)
69 schemes_n--; /* Invalidate the file scheme */
70 schemes[schemes_n++] = scheme_copy;
71 }
72 }
73
74 ERR_set_mark();
75
76 /* Try each scheme until we find one that could open the URI */
77 for (i = 0; loader_ctx == NULL && i < schemes_n; i++) {
78 OSSL_TRACE1(STORE, "Looking up scheme %s\n", schemes[i]);
79 if ((loader = ossl_store_get0_loader_int(schemes[i])) != NULL) {
80 OSSL_TRACE1(STORE, "Found loader for scheme %s\n", schemes[i]);
81 loader_ctx = loader->open(loader, uri, ui_method, ui_data);
82 OSSL_TRACE2(STORE, "Opened %s => %p\n", uri, (void *)loader_ctx);
83 }
84 }
85
86 if (loader_ctx == NULL)
87 goto err;
88
89 if ((ctx = OPENSSL_zalloc(sizeof(*ctx))) == NULL) {
90 OSSL_STOREerr(OSSL_STORE_F_OSSL_STORE_OPEN, ERR_R_MALLOC_FAILURE);
91 goto err;
92 }
93
94 ctx->loader = loader;
95 ctx->loader_ctx = loader_ctx;
96 ctx->ui_method = ui_method;
97 ctx->ui_data = ui_data;
98 ctx->post_process = post_process;
99 ctx->post_process_data = post_process_data;
100
101 /*
102 * If the attempt to open with the 'file' scheme loader failed and the
103 * other scheme loader succeeded, the failure to open with the 'file'
104 * scheme loader leaves an error on the error stack. Let's remove it.
105 */
106 ERR_pop_to_mark();
107
108 return ctx;
109
110 err:
111 ERR_clear_last_mark();
112 if (loader_ctx != NULL) {
113 /*
114 * We ignore a returned error because we will return NULL anyway in
115 * this case, so if something goes wrong when closing, that'll simply
116 * just add another entry on the error stack.
117 */
118 (void)loader->close(loader_ctx);
119 }
120 return NULL;
121 }

172 OSSL_STORE_INFO *OSSL_STORE_load(OSSL_STORE_CTX *ctx)
173 {
174 OSSL_STORE_INFO *v = NULL;
175
176 ctx->loading = 1;
177 again:
178 if (OSSL_STORE_eof(ctx))
179 return NULL;
180
181 OSSL_TRACE(STORE, "Loading next object\n");
182 v = ctx->loader->load(ctx->loader_ctx, ctx->ui_method, ctx->ui_data);
183
184 if (ctx->post_process != NULL && v != NULL) {
185 v = ctx->post_process(v, ctx->post_process_data);
186
187 /*
188 * By returning NULL, the callback decides that this object should
189 * be ignored.
190 */
191 if (v == NULL)
192 goto again;
193 }
194
195 if (v != NULL && ctx->expected_type != 0) {
196 int returned_type = OSSL_STORE_INFO_get_type(v);
197
198 if (returned_type != OSSL_STORE_INFO_NAME && returned_type != 0) {
199 /*
200 * Soft assert here so those who want to harsly weed out faulty
201 * loaders can do so using a debugging version of libcrypto.
202 */
203 if (ctx->loader->expect != NULL)
204 assert(ctx->expected_type == returned_type);
205
206 if (ctx->expected_type != returned_type) {
207 OSSL_STORE_INFO_free(v);
208 goto again;
209 }
210 }
211 }
212
213 if (v != NULL)
214 OSSL_TRACE1(STORE, "Got a %s\n",
215 OSSL_STORE_INFO_type_string(OSSL_STORE_INFO_get_type(v)));
216
217 return v;
218 }
